键入位置路径,而不是在文件选择器对话框中单击目录按钮?


18

有没有办法更改文件选择器对话框的路径输入?我想自己输入路径,而不是单击按钮来指定目标路径。在Nautilus中,我可以按Ctrl+ L,以显示路径文本框。在“ 将页面另存为”对话框中,相同的快捷方式将我命名为文本框。


2
感谢您的Ctrl-L提示!我只是在寻找
Dave

Answers:


13

我将Nautilus设置为始终显示位置栏而不是按钮,并且在Firefox中,我也默认看到位置栏(我相信您想要的)。

为此,您必须更改gconf / dconf条目。

截至Ubuntu 11.10:

gconftool-2 --set /apps/nautilus/preferences/always_use_location_entry --type=bool true

从12.04 LTS起:

gsettings set org.gnome.nautilus.preferences always-use-location-entry true

可能需要重新启动nautilus(使用nautilus -q)以查看效果,但可能没有。


2
感谢您的快速解答。它可以在nautilus中工作,但不能在firefox文件选择器对话框中工作。当我Ctrl+S在Firefox中点击时,路径按钮仍然存在。当我打开鹦鹉螺(即:位置->主文件夹)时,位置文本框在那里,我可以键入路径。我从会话注销并重新登录。Firefox对话框没有变化。还有什么我可以尝试的吗?
Casual Coder 2010年

1
抱歉,我认为您的意思是文件选择器,例如上载对话框(确实如此)。我不知道为什么会这样,因为您已经明确表示要在保存对话中使用。奇怪的是,对于打开/保存对话框也没有这样做。奇怪的是,这在其他事情(例如Gedit)中仍然有效,并且Firefox应该使用本机窗口小部件。我怀疑加载对话的方式存在错误。我会继续寻找。
奥利(Oli)

2
是的,我说的是上下文菜单中的“页面另存为”对话框和“元素另存为”对话框。他们两个都缺少“打开文件”对话框中的“铅笔”图标。使用“打开文件”对话框中的此图标,我可以打开“位置”文本框,并且此设置将保留。也可以使用Ctrl+L快捷方式。我也想在“另存为”对话框中也有这种行为。再次感谢您的时间和精力。
Casual Coder 2010年

5

在Ubuntu 12.04及更高版本中,您可以使用Ubuntu Tweak在Nautilus中默认设置地址栏。

因此,打开Ubuntu Tweak,转到“ Tweaks”选项卡,选择“ File Manage”,然后将此字段置于ON 位置使用位置条目而不是路径栏

在此处输入图片说明

终端,您可以使用以下命令进行相同的操作:

gsettings set org.gnome.nautilus.preferences always-use-location-entry true

现在,在“ 保存文件”窗口对话框中的“ 名称 ”字段中,如果为要保存的文件插入一个绝对值,则该文件将保存在该路径中:

在此处输入图片说明

在“ 打开文件”窗口对话框中的“ 位置 ”字段中,如果要插入任何位置路径,然后按Enter,您将被定向到该位置。

在此处输入图片说明


对我来说,这不是一个可以接受的解决方案,因为我希望能够将路径(即已经可见的面包屑)复制到剪贴板!当大多数人使用键盘时,Ubuntu为什么要使鼠标友好呢?
Sanjay Manohar,

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.